草庐IT

symfony-components

全部标签

forms - 覆盖 symfony2 上的表单验证消息

如何覆盖symfony2中的表单验证消息。虽然有一个validation.xml文件相关的模型类。我认为它验证了基于html5的表单。“请匹配请求的格式”,“请填写此字段”。有什么方法可以覆盖此验证消息。请在这方面帮助我,我被困了一天多了,因为我对symfony完全陌生 最佳答案 您看到的那些消息是由浏览器创建的HTML5验证消息。如果要覆盖它们,则需要将oninvalid属性添加到与该字段关联的输入标签。您可以通过两种方式执行此操作:在您的Controller或表单类型中,将此属性添加到表单字段:$builder->add('em

forms - 覆盖 symfony2 上的表单验证消息

如何覆盖symfony2中的表单验证消息。虽然有一个validation.xml文件相关的模型类。我认为它验证了基于html5的表单。“请匹配请求的格式”,“请填写此字段”。有什么方法可以覆盖此验证消息。请在这方面帮助我,我被困了一天多了,因为我对symfony完全陌生 最佳答案 您看到的那些消息是由浏览器创建的HTML5验证消息。如果要覆盖它们,则需要将oninvalid属性添加到与该字段关联的输入标签。您可以通过两种方式执行此操作:在您的Controller或表单类型中,将此属性添加到表单字段:$builder->add('em

html - 将 novalidate 属性包含到 Symfony2 twig 模板中

我正在尝试禁用我的表单的HTML5验证,我已经看到我可以将novalidate包含到表单标签中,但是我正在使用{{form_start(contact)}}{{form_end(contact)}}创建我的表单。现在根据我一直在阅读的内容,我应该能够在form_start中包含一个属性,这样代码就会给我这个{{form_start(contact,{'attr':{'novalidate'}})然而,这不起作用...有人有任何想法吗? 最佳答案 您需要一个键/值对:{{form_start(contact,{attr:{novali

html - 将 novalidate 属性包含到 Symfony2 twig 模板中

我正在尝试禁用我的表单的HTML5验证,我已经看到我可以将novalidate包含到表单标签中,但是我正在使用{{form_start(contact)}}{{form_end(contact)}}创建我的表单。现在根据我一直在阅读的内容,我应该能够在form_start中包含一个属性,这样代码就会给我这个{{form_start(contact,{'attr':{'novalidate'}})然而,这不起作用...有人有任何想法吗? 最佳答案 您需要一个键/值对:{{form_start(contact,{attr:{novali

unzip 解压大文件出现错误invalid zip file with overlapped components (possible zip bomb)(linux分卷解压大文件错误解决)

先安装p7zipsudoapt-getinstallp7zipsudoapt-getinstallp7zip-fullsudoapt-getinstallp7zip-rar再使用p7zip进行解压7zx001.zip(首文件)解决小文件用常见方法就行了1zip-s0split.zip--outunsplit.zipunzipunslit.zip2cat c.zip.* >d.zip解压unzipd.zip(可能会出错)

html - Symfony2 和 Twitter Bootstrap

我今天刚刚在SO上看到TwitterBootstrap。我已经略读了一些在线教程,如果到目前为止我的理解是正确的,那么使用TB基本上包括:下载TB,提取CSS文件等在您的HTML文档中引用所需的CSS、JS文件并使用定义的CSS模式我想将TwitterBootstrap与Symfony2结合使用。鉴于我对如何使用TB的理解,我认为将它与Symfony一起使用会相对容易,所以我很惊讶地看到有(实际上有几个)Bundle可以与Symfony一起使用。所以我的问题是:为什么需要Bundle才能将TwitterBootstrap与Symfony2一起使用?-我上面解释的方法是否不起作用(即直接

html - Symfony2 和 Twitter Bootstrap

我今天刚刚在SO上看到TwitterBootstrap。我已经略读了一些在线教程,如果到目前为止我的理解是正确的,那么使用TB基本上包括:下载TB,提取CSS文件等在您的HTML文档中引用所需的CSS、JS文件并使用定义的CSS模式我想将TwitterBootstrap与Symfony2结合使用。鉴于我对如何使用TB的理解,我认为将它与Symfony一起使用会相对容易,所以我很惊讶地看到有(实际上有几个)Bundle可以与Symfony一起使用。所以我的问题是:为什么需要Bundle才能将TwitterBootstrap与Symfony2一起使用?-我上面解释的方法是否不起作用(即直接

ios - react native : Setting flex:1 on a ScrollView contentContainerStyle causes overlapping of components

问题:我有一个带有2个subview的ScrollView,我希望它们中的第一个(我们称它为ViewA)有{flex:1},这样另一个(ViewB)就会粘在屏幕底部——但前提是它们总高度小于屏幕。当然,如果它们高于屏幕,我希望它像往常一样滚动。案例1(良好):带有长文本的ViewA,ViewB随之滚动。https://rnplay.org/apps/slCivA情况2(不好):带有短文本的ViewA,ViewB没有固定在底部。https://rnplay.org/apps/OmQakQ尝试过的解决方案:所以我将ScrollView的样式和contentContainerStyle设置为

ios - react native : Setting flex:1 on a ScrollView contentContainerStyle causes overlapping of components

问题:我有一个带有2个subview的ScrollView,我希望它们中的第一个(我们称它为ViewA)有{flex:1},这样另一个(ViewB)就会粘在屏幕底部——但前提是它们总高度小于屏幕。当然,如果它们高于屏幕,我希望它像往常一样滚动。案例1(良好):带有长文本的ViewA,ViewB随之滚动。https://rnplay.org/apps/slCivA情况2(不好):带有短文本的ViewA,ViewB没有固定在底部。https://rnplay.org/apps/OmQakQ尝试过的解决方案:所以我将ScrollView的样式和contentContainerStyle设置为

@Component注解的使用及解析

1.@Component注解的含义@Componet注解为Bean的定义表示此类为Spring容器中的一个Bean,将该类交给Spring管理相当于2.@Component注解的具体实现@Component可作用于类、接口、枚举类型等(Target)@Component生命周期为运行时(Retention)@Component可以使用JavaDoc命令生成文档后查看说明(Documented)@Component该类会存储到META-INF/spring.components(Indexed)3.@Component解析3.1通过Component的package找到其jarspring-co